<p><b>Ignite children's love for science with Janice VanCleave's new book of fun experiments</b> <p>Everyone's favorite science teacher, Janice VanCleave, has mastered the art of creating fun, instructive, and safe science experiments. Step-by-step, <i>Janice VanCleave's Big Book of Science Experiments</i> walks teachers, parents, and students through the process of successfully completing fascinating and informative science investigations. Designed to perform in the classroom or at home, each experiment contains background information, a list of materials needed, clear instructions, a description of what is expected to happen, and an explanation of why it happened. The investigation continues with thought-provoking questions and suggestions for thinking through the science behind the experiment. <p>With 100 intriguing experiments, both new and tried-and-true, you can bring chemistry, physics, astronomy, Earth science, and biology into your classroom or home. From creating gooey slime and erupting volcanoes to predicting the next moon phase and a few magic tricks, students will see science all around them in their everyday lives. <p>For years, teachers and parents have relied on Janice VanCleave to bring them the most informative and engaging scientific information appropriate for young learners. And now, <i>Janice VanCleave's Big Book of Science Experiments</i> is the book that can help students and teachers open the door to the magic and mystery of the amazing world of science.
